Discovering a tool shop nearby can be as basic as a few clicks or a brief drive. Here are some reliable techniques:
Online Search Engines: Use Google or Bing. Enter "tool store near me" and evaluate the Google Maps recommendations, that include user scores and hours of operation.
Resident Business Directories: Websites like Yelp or Yellow Pages can offer detailed lists of regional tool shops in addition to consumer evaluations.
Social network: Platforms like Facebook, Instagram, and Reddit often have neighborhood groups where locals share suggestions.
Word of Mouth: Ask buddies, family, or co-workers for their preferred local tool shops.
Regional Hardware Stores: Big-box home improvement stores might also have tool areas, but local hardware shops often cater to more particular requirements.
